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ions PHPGurukul Hospital Management System version 1.0
Description A problematic vulnerability was found in the PHPGurukul Hospital Management System, affecting an unknown part of the file registration.php. The manipulation of the First Name argument leads to cross-site scripting. It is possible to initiate the attack rem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used.
Recommendations For PHPGurukul Hospital Management System version 1.0, consider disabling the First Name argument in the registration.php file until a patch is available to prevent cross-site scripting attacks. Restrict access to the registration.php file to minimize the risk of exploitation. Avoid using the First Name argument in the affected file until the issue is resolved. At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.
